Position Summary
We are seeking a skilled and security-conscious Microsoft 365 Administrator to join our team as we continue a major transition to Microsoft cloud services across our hybrid environment. We require a professional who will bring a deep understanding of Microsoft 365 technologies, and hybrid infrastructure integration. This role is critical to ensuring the secure and efficient rollout of cloud services, while maintaining a seamless experience for users across on-premises and cloud platforms.
Key Responsibilities- Lead the administration of Microsoft 365 services with a focus on Exchange Online, and Microsoft Teams, within a hybrid Active Directory environment.
- Collaborate with stakeholders across CT, Info Sec, and compliance to align corporate messaging with regulatory and risk management frameworks.
- Collaborate with other roles to deliver M365 messaging integration and improvement opportunities.
- Manage hybrid mail flow, user identity synchronization (AAD Connect), licensing, MFA, and Conditional Access Policies.
- Serve as a subject matter expert on Microsoft Exchange Online and Microsoft Teams architecture and help define governance models for the aforementioned systems.
- Provide support for data loss prevention (DLP), eDiscovery, sensitivity labeling, encryption policies, and retention policies using within the messaging ecosystem.
- Monitor and maintain system performance, uptime, service health, and compliance using the Microsoft 365 admin center, Microsoft Defender for Office 365, and Azure Monitor.
- Work closely with Info Sec and audit teams to ensure compliance with banking industry regulations and prepare for internal and external audits.
- Document procedures, configurations, and change controls aligned with ITIL standards and the organization’s change management policies.
- Assist in the development of user training and provide tier‑3 support to IT teams and power users.
- 5‑7 years of experience administering Microsoft 365 (Exchange Online and Teams a plus) in a medium to large enterprise, ideally in the banking or financial services industry.
- Strong experience managing hybrid Exchange environments, Entra (Azure AD), and identity synchronization tools (e.g., Azure AD Connect, AD FS).
- Understanding of Microsoft 365 security and compliance tools, including Purview, Conditional Access, MFA, and Microsoft Defender.
- Proficiency with Power Shell scripting for automation, bulk administration, and reporting.
- Familiarity with data residency, retention, and regulatory requirements specific to financial institutions.
- Demonstrated ability to lead or support email migrations, and Teams governance in hybrid environments.
- Excellent communication, collaboration, and documentation skills.
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field—or equivalent experience.
- Microsoft certifications such as MS‑102 (Microsoft 365 Administrator), MS‑500 (Security Administrator), or AZ‑104 (Azure Administrator).
- Background in supporting IT audits and risk assessments in a financial institution.
- Experience with automation tools (e.g., Power Automate, Microsoft Graph API) is a plus.
